Local business community to shine during Portage event

Portage businesses that have been looking for a way to showcase themselves to their community may wish to make plans now to be part of this spring’s Community and Business Night, which is one of the ways the local Chamber of Commerce serves its membership.

Provided it goes ahead amid responses to the coronavirus outbreak, this will be the 27th year for the annual Portage Community and Business Night, and this year’s event will have a Roaring 20s theme. There are several ways for a business or group to get involved in the evening, and both Chamber members and non-members alike are welcome to take part.

Companies can book a booth space now, and there are several options available for this. Food trucks and other mobile food vendors can also reserve a space, and not-for-profit groups are also welcome. It is expected that as many as 800 community members will attend the event, making it a great chance for the businesses and groups that take part to introduce themselves to their community.

The 2020 Portage Community and Business Night plans to showcase area companies on April 16. Woodland Park will serve as the venue for the occasion.
